Use stored SITE_DOMAIN as default in Caddy domain prompt

lib/common.sh: configure_caddy_for_service now pre-fills the domain prompt
with $DEFAULT_SUBDOMAIN.$SITE_DOMAIN when a site domain has been configured
(setup.sh configure / ~/docker/.config). No more typing the full domain for
every service — just press Enter to accept the default.

services/mattermost.sh: remove redundant custom Caddy/domain block added in
the previous commit. MATTERMOST_SITE_URL is already computed from SITE_DOMAIN
before configure_caddy_for_service is called, so the simple call is sufficient.
